Lifeguard / Pool Attendant / Water Safety Officer
Position Overview
The Lifeguard is responsible for ensuring the safety of guests, staff, and visitors at pools, waterparks, and water-themed facilities within the hotel. The role includes monitoring water activities, preventing accidents, responding to emergencies, and enforcing safety regulations in line with UAE/GCC health and safety laws.
Department: Recreation / Pools / Water Parks / Guest Services
Reports To: Aquatic Supervisor / Recreation Manager / Health & Safety Officer
Key Responsibilities
Safety & Surveillance
- Monitor all aquatic areas constantly to ensure guest safety.
- Identify and respond to potential hazards or unsafe behaviors.
- Enforce pool, waterpark, and water facility rules and regulations.
- Prevent accidents by controlling crowd behavior and advising guests on safe practices.
Emergency Response
- Perform rescues and administer first aid, CPR, and life-saving procedures when necessary.
- Respond promptly to all accidents, medical emergencies, or incidents.
- Notify supervisors and management of emergencies and prepare incident reports.
- Maintain composure and follow emergency protocols during high-stress situations.
Guest Service & Communication
- Provide information and guidance to guests regarding water safety and facility usage.
- Maintain professional and courteous interaction with guests at all times.
- Assist guests with poolside facilities, floatation devices, and safety equipment.
Equipment & Facility Management
- Check lifeguard equipment (rescue tubes, buoys, first aid kits, communication devices) daily.
- Inspect pool areas, slides, and water features for hazards or maintenance issues.
- Report faulty equipment or unsafe conditions to maintenance or management immediately.
- Ensure hygiene and cleanliness of poolside and water-themed areas.
Training & Compliance
- Stay updated on UAE/GCC safety regulations, pool codes, and life-saving protocols.
- Attend training sessions, drills, and refresher courses in first aid, CPR, and water rescue.
- Ensure compliance with local municipality and hotel safety policies.
